Attorney Sarah E. Kay Tour Leader and Mock Trial Participant at HAWL Take Your Child to Work Day Courthouse Event

April 28, 2017

On April 27, 2017, Attorney Sarah E. Kay lead a courthouse tour and served as an attorney in a mock trial presentation as a part of the Hillsborough Association for Women Lawyers (HAWL) annual Take Your Child to Work Day event.  Sarah will begin her term as President of HAWL on June 1, 2017.  The attorneys of Sessums Black believe that a successful combination must include one’s education, legal practice, trial work, and public service.

Attorney Sarah E. Kay (back row far left) and the 2017 HAWL Take Your Child to Work Day mock trial cast

Attorney Sarah E. Kay recognized for her Pro Bono Work

April 24, 2017

At the 13th Judicial Circuit Pro Bono Committee Awards Ceremony on April 20, 2017, Attorney Sarah E. Kay was recognized with other attorneys who donated 100+ hours of pro bono legal service in 2016.   As part of the recognition, Sarah was presented with a gold lapel pin as well as a letter from the Supreme Court of Florida which thanked her for “giving freely and unselfishly of [her] time and legal talent to represent the poor, the powerless, the defenseless, and the oppressed among us.”  In the letter, Justice Labarga commented “Your work helps to fulfill the promise of equal justice for all.” Click on the link below to read the letter.  Congratulations, Sarah!
